Players have discovered that Tiny Tina's Wonderlands launched to generally favorable reviews last week, offering a fresh but familiar experience in the expansive Borderlands universe. That s have already begun to encounter save data-related woes hardly comes as a surprise, though, especially to anyone familiar with the lost progress issues that plagued 2019's Borderlands 3 release.

Developer Gearbox Software and publisher Take-Two Interactive announced Tiny Tina's Wonderlands as a fantasy-centric Borderlands spinoff during the Geoff Keighley-hosted Summer Game Fest 2021. Notably, the adventure places a Dungeons & Dragons spin on the whimsy and over-the-top action of Borderlands, an idea that follows in the footsteps of Borderlands 2's Tiny Tina's Assault on Dragon Keep expansion - which later launched as a standalone game. And while it seems many players have gotten nothing but enjoyment out of the latest Tiny Tina-starring adventure, plenty of other s regularly run into errors that impede core game progress.

Since the cloud save on file seemed the most up-to-date, Tassi selected it - "that lost me my progress." Popular streamer Gothalion described a similar experience in a brief Twitter thread, arguing that Borderlands needs "server-side saves."

Again, this constitutes an issue that's plagued Borderlands games for years. Why Gearbox Software and 2K Games have yet to address it remains a mystery. Without a surefire way to recover lost progress, all Tiny Tina's Wonderlands s can do is hope that Gearbox can develop a fix. Borderlands faithful should also keep their fingers crossed for server-side save solutions in the next mainline entry.

Days ahead of release, Gearbox teased its post-launch plans for Tiny Tina's Wonderlands. The Season will boast four separate content drops, featuring a seventh class, new explorable settings, additional boss characters, and a whole host of extra cosmetic items in the Butt Stallion Pack. At the time of writing, though, there's no word on when such content will begin rolling out.
